RDF
RDF (Resource Description Framework) is a foundation for processing metadata; it provides interoperability between applications that exchange machine-understandable information on the Web.

XML
XML (Extensible Markup Language) is a standard that defines a generic syntax used to markup data with simple, human-readable tags.
2000-10-06
Namespaces
An XML namespace is a collection of names, identified by a URI reference, which are used in XML documents as element types and attribute names.

XSLT
XSLT (Extensible Stylesheet Language Transformations) is a language for transforming XML documents from one structure to another.
1999-11-16
XPath
XPath (XML Path Language) is a language for addressing the parts of an XML document. It also provides basic facilities for manipulation of strings, numbers and booleans.
